@charset "utf-8";
.conteudoshimmer {
    background-color: #FFF;    
    height: 350px;
    overflow: hidden;
    width: 100%;
    margin: 10px auto;  
}

.shimmerBG {
    animation-duration: 2.2s;
    animation-fill-mode: forwards;
    animation-iteration-count: infinite;
    animation-name: shimmer;
    animation-timing-function: linear;
    background: #ddd;
    background: linear-gradient(to right, #F6F6F6 8%, #F0F0F0 18%, #F6F6F6 33%);
    background-size: 1200px 100%;
  }

@-webkit-keyframes shimmer {
    0% {
        background-position: -100% 0;
    }
    100% {
        background-position: 100% 0;
    }
}

@keyframes shimmer {
    0% {
        background-position: -1200px 0;
    }
    100% {
        background-position: 1200px 0;
    }
}
  
    .media {
    height: 137px;	
	width:200px;
	padding:0;
	margin:0 auto;
}

.p-32 {
    padding: 16px;
}

.title-line {
    height: 80px;
    width: 100%;
    margin-bottom: 12px;
    border-radius: 15px;
}

.title-line1 {
    height: 40px;
    width: 100%;
    margin-bottom: 12px;
    border-radius: 10px;
}

.content-line {
    height: 8px;
    width: 100%;
    margin-bottom: 16px;
    border-radius: 8px;
	padding:0 20px;
}
  
  .end {
      width: 40%;
    }

}


.m-t-24 {
    margin-top: 24px;
}